site stats

Doctrine composite primary key

WebDoctrine does not check if you are re-adding entities with a primary key that already exists or adding entities to a collection twice. You have to check for both conditions yourself in the code before calling $em->flush () if you know that unique constraint failures can occur. WebApr 26, 2024 · To know what a composite key is we need to have the knowledge of what a primary key is, a primary key is a column that has a unique and not null value in an SQL table. Now a composite key is also a primary key, but the difference is that it is made by the combination of more than one column to identify the particular row in the table.

Annotations Reference - Doctrine Object Relational Mapper …

WebDoctrine2 do not manage foreign composite keys to reference an entity with its composite primary keys The cases where Doctrine2 manage correctly composite primary keys are mainly : OneToMany: The associated entity (ArticleAttributes) uses as primary key, the primary key of the referenced entity (Artile) and an other self field (attribute) WebMay 22, 2024 · $ composer show --latest 'symfony/*' symfony/assetic-bundle v2.8.2 v2.8.2 Integrates Assetic into Symfony2 symfony/monolog-bundle v2.12.1 v3.2.0 Symfony MonologBundle symfony/phpunit-bridge v2.8.40 v4.0.10 Symfony PHPUnit Bridge symfony/polyfill-apcu v1.8.0 v1.8.0 Symfony polyfill backporting apcu_* functions to … race horsing games https://ninjabeagle.com

DDC-3565: "Missing value for primary key" error using ... - Github

WebNov 14, 2016 · @zsimaiof I'm sorry but, as you said yourself, the problem is that this bundle doesn't support composite Doctrine keys. We don't plan to add this feature anytime soon, so I must close this issue as "won't fix". I know that this is disappointing, but to make this bundle as simple as possible, we needed to make some trade-offs and not include … WebMar 22, 2024 · At the moment the loader command is working fine for tables with a simple primary key. But now I have a table, which consists of a composited primary key (of three columns). Two Columns... WebDoctrine manages the persistence of all classes marked as entities. Optional attributes: repositoryClass: Specifies the FQCN of a subclass of the EntityRepository. Use of repositories for entities is encouraged to keep specialized DQL and SQL operations separated from the Model/Domain Layer. race hot wheels

Use composite foreign key a part of a composite primary …

Category:Composite and Foreign Keys as Primary Key — Doctrine 2 ORM …

Tags:Doctrine composite primary key

Doctrine composite primary key

Composite and Foreign Keys as Primary Key — Doctrine 2 …

http://doctrine2.readthedocs.io/en/latest/tutorials/composite-primary-keys.html WebJava 如何在Hibernate中映射多个复合键?,java,mysql,hibernate,hibernate-mapping,composite-primary-key,Java,Mysql,Hibernate,Hibernate Mapping,Composite Primary Key,我有一个有3个主键的表。它们是自定义id、患者id、服务提供商类型、服务提 …

Doctrine composite primary key

Did you know?

WebSql 使用交集实体中的复合外键作为主键?,sql,foreign-keys,primary-key,composite-primary-key,Sql,Foreign Keys,Primary Key,Composite Primary Key,我有四个表,2个是独立的实体,一个交叉实体将这两个连接在一起,第三个表引用交叉实体。 WebDec 28, 2024 · Even if the primary key can be composite (built of several columns), it is a widespread good practice to dedicate a special column (often named id or id_WebApr 26, 2024 · To know what a composite key is we need to have the knowledge of what a primary key is, a primary key is a column that has a unique and not null value in an SQL table. Now a composite key is also a primary key, but the difference is that it is made by the combination of more than one column to identify the particular row in the table.WebOct 12, 2024 · Composite : means a combination of multiple components. primary key: means a key that can uniquely identify the rows in a table. Also, the key cannot be null. Therefore by combining the above definitions, we can say that a composite primary key is a primary key formed by combining one or more keys (columns) from the table.WebMysql 将MyISAM转换为InnoDB,其中表有两列(复合)PK,其中一列是自动增量,mysql,primary-key,innodb,auto-increment,composite-key,Mysql,Primary Key,Innodb,Auto Increment,Composite Key,我想将一些MyISAM表转换为InnoDB,这样我就可以利用外键支持。WebFeb 11, 2015 · I had a very similar problem. Although all of the ID columns are configured properly, I was receiving [Doctrine\Common\Proxy\Exception\OutOfBoundsException] Missing value for primary key id onWebDoctrine ORM is an object-relational mapper (ORM) for PHP 7.1+ that provides transparent persistence for PHP objects. It uses the Data Mapper pattern at the heart, aiming for a complete separation of your domain/business logic from the persistence in a relational database management system.WebJun 7, 2024 · The @JoinColumn annotation combined with a @OneToOne mapping indicates that a given column in the owner entity refers to a primary key in the reference entity: @Entity public class Office { @OneToOne (fetch = FetchType.LAZY) @JoinColumn (name = "addressId") private Address address; } CopyWebDoctrine does not check if you are re-adding entities with a primary key that already exists or adding entities to a collection twice. You have to check for both conditions yourself in the code before calling $em->flush () if you know that unique constraint failures can occur.WebAug 4, 2011 · php app/console generate:doctrine:crud --entity = AcmeBlogBundle:Post --format = annotation --with-write --no-interaction I got this error... CRUD generation [RuntimeException] The CRUD generator...WebJan 21, 2024 · A Composite Primary Keyis created by combining two or more columns in a table that can be used to uniquely identify each row in the table when the columns are combined, but it does not guarantee uniqueness when taken individually, or it can also be understood as a primary key created by combining two or more attributes to uniquely …Web2010-11-24 13:50:10 3 8879 php / mysql / doctrine / pdo / communication-protocol Zend Table Relationship with Primary Composite Key - delete record from table 2010-11-21 11:51:22 1 1079 php / zend-db-tableWebJan 16, 2024 · If we estimate that we actually lose only a single byte of entropy, the collisions risk is still negligible. You now have a 50% chance to get a collision every …WebComposite keys are a very powerful relational database concept and we took good care to make sure Doctrine 2 supports as many of the composite primary key use-cases. For Doctrine 2.0 composite keys of primitive data-types are supported, for Doctrine 2.1 even foreign keys as primary keys are supported.WebMar 22, 2024 · At the moment the loader command is working fine for tables with a simple primary key. But now I have a table, which consists of a composited primary key (of three columns). Two Columns...WebComposite and Foreign Keys as Primary Key. General Considerations; Primitive Types only; Identity through foreign Entities; Use-Case 1: Dynamic Attributes; Use-Case 2: …WebOct 12, 2024 · Primary Key in SQL; Conclusion. Composite primary key combines two or more columns to form a primary key for the table. To add a composite primary key to …WebMay 22, 2024 · $ composer show --latest 'symfony/*' symfony/assetic-bundle v2.8.2 v2.8.2 Integrates Assetic into Symfony2 symfony/monolog-bundle v2.12.1 v3.2.0 Symfony MonologBundle symfony/phpunit-bridge v2.8.40 v4.0.10 Symfony PHPUnit Bridge symfony/polyfill-apcu v1.8.0 v1.8.0 Symfony polyfill backporting apcu_* functions to …WebDoctrine manages the persistence of all classes marked as entities. Optional attributes: repositoryClass: Specifies the FQCN of a subclass of the EntityRepository. Use of repositories for entities is encouraged to keep specialized DQL and SQL operations separated from the Model/Domain Layer.WebNov 14, 2016 · @zsimaiof I'm sorry but, as you said yourself, the problem is that this bundle doesn't support composite Doctrine keys. We don't plan to add this feature anytime soon, so I must close this issue as "won't fix". I know that this is disappointing, but to make this bundle as simple as possible, we needed to make some trade-offs and not include …WebComposite primary keys describe an entity that has multiple primary keys that are automatically combined in one "composite primary key". This way of modelling your database has advantages and disadvantages.WebApr 10, 2024 · I have two tables with a FK relation between them. The parent table has a composite primary key over two columns, one of which is used to link the child table.. What is interesting is that when I try to fetch a list of parents having their children linked using explicit INNER JOIN I receive duplicates. The count of the duplicates hints that …Web我想我需要businessDomain和orderId来引用订单。如果只使用businessDomain,我将获得每个orderItem的数百万订单。对不起。WebApr 17, 2024 · About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...WebComposite keys are a very powerful relational database concept and we took good care to make sure Doctrine 2 supports as many of the composite primary key use-cases. For … ) to this end. This special column is used to technically identify records and can be used as foreign keys in relations. ℹ️ NOTEWebSql 使用交集实体中的复合外键作为主键?,sql,foreign-keys,primary-key,composite-primary-key,Sql,Foreign Keys,Primary Key,Composite Primary Key,我有四个表,2个是独立的实体,一个交叉实体将这两个连接在一起,第三个表引用交叉实体。

WebComposite keys are a very powerful relational database concept and we took good care to make sure Doctrine 2 supports as many of the composite primary key use-cases. For …

WebApr 17, 2024 · About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... WebThe meaning of DOCTRINE is a principle or position or the body of principles in a branch of knowledge or system of belief : dogma. How to use doctrine in a sentence. Did you know?

WebFeb 11, 2015 · I had a very similar problem. Although all of the ID columns are configured properly, I was receiving [Doctrine\Common\Proxy\Exception\OutOfBoundsException] Missing value for primary key id on

WebOnce a composite primary key is used in an entity, a refactoring of its key can lead to substantial amount of additional refactoring. Since an entity with a composite primary … shoeburyness testingWebJan 22, 2024 · Introduction While answering questions on the Hibernate forum, I stumbled on the following question about using the @ManyToOne annotation when the Foreign Key column on the client side references a non-Primary Key column on the parent side. In this article, you are going to see how to use the @JoinColumn annotation in order to … shoeburyness swimming pool opening timesWebComposite keys are a very powerful relational database concept and we took good care to make sure Doctrine 2 supports as many of the composite primary key use-cases. For Doctrine 2.0 composite keys of primitive data-types are supported, for Doctrine 2.1 even foreign keys as primary keys are supported. race hourse findinghttp://doctrine2.readthedocs.io/en/latest/tutorials/composite-primary-keys.html racehub facebookWebOct 12, 2024 · Primary Key in SQL; Conclusion. Composite primary key combines two or more columns to form a primary key for the table. To add a composite primary key to … shoeburyness test siteWebMysql 将MyISAM转换为InnoDB,其中表有两列(复合)PK,其中一列是自动增量,mysql,primary-key,innodb,auto-increment,composite-key,Mysql,Primary Key,Innodb,Auto Increment,Composite Key,我想将一些MyISAM表转换为InnoDB,这样我就可以利用外键支持。 race hout bayWebJan 16, 2024 · If we estimate that we actually lose only a single byte of entropy, the collisions risk is still negligible. You now have a 50% chance to get a collision every … race hub brands hatch